Les Chroniques d'Angleterre, Volume IV
This manuscript is volume IV in a set of five from the collection "Recueil des chroniques et anchiennes istories de la Grant Bretaigne," written by Phillip the Good's counselor and chamberlain Jean de Wavrin. It chronicles the history of England from the early years of the rei...

| provenance |
provenance
Robert Blathwayt, Dyrham Park, Chippenham, England, 19th century (?) [1]. Sotheby's Sale, London, November 20 1912, lot 125; purchased by Sabin, London, 1912. Leo S. Olschki, Florence [2]; purchased by Henry Walters, Baltimore, before 1914; by bequest to Walters Art Museum, 1931.[1] The manuscript has possible evidence of two previous provenance episodes: visible brown ink inscription (""27-6"" on fol. 1) possibly indicative of price and related to this volume's separation from the set of three others (II, III, V) mentioned in the 1686 inventory of the library of William III of Orange; ex-libris (cropped, in brown, faded ink) on fol. 2 reads ""Philipp. Franc...,"" ca. 1700[2] His inventory number 35396 on front pastedown in pencil
